Ambient Lighting Installation and Cost for the E300 W213
The ambient lighting retrofit focuses on replacing the standard air vents with units that incorporate LED illumination. This isn't a simple add-on; it involves replacing the entire vent assembly. The process is designed for a seamless 1:1 replacement, meaning the new illuminated vents fit directly into the existing openings without requiring significant modifications to the dashboard. This ensures a factory-like integration. In Korea, the estimated ambient lighting cost for this upgrade on a Mercedes E300 W213, covering both front and rear vents, typically ranges from 300,000 to 600,000 KRW (approximately $220 - $440 USD, subject to exchange rates). This price can vary based on the specific product quality and whether front and rear vents are included in the package. The addition of Burmester electric tweeters is a separate upgrade, often performed concurrently, which further enhances the premium feel of the interior.
Before and After: The Impact of Vent Ambient Lighting
The visual transformation after installing vent ambient lighting is striking. Even when the lights are off, the design of the new vents can offer a subtle aesthetic upgrade. However, the true magic happens when the ambient lighting is activated. The illumination emanates softly, creating a luxurious and inviting atmosphere without causing glare, which is crucial for a comfortable driving experience, especially at night. For later models, like the 2018 E300, the system can integrate with the car's existing multi-color ambient lighting settings, allowing for dynamic color changes and dual-color configurations. This seamless integration makes the upgrade feel like an original factory option. Proper alignment of the vents is key to achieving the most aesthetically pleasing result, highlighting the importance of professional installation.

Q. How is ambient lighting installed on a Mercedes-Benz E-Class W213?
Installation involves a 1:1 replacement of the original air vents with illuminated units. 1. Existing vents are carefully removed. 2. New illuminated vent assemblies are fitted into place. 3. Wiring is connected to the vehicle's ambient lighting system for seamless control.
